Transaction 20052c4750276dd67322e05e4dfdf40f2103936f7e26f8051d5af20dac493e13
1 Input
2 Outputs
- 20052c4750276dd67322e05e4dfdf40f2103936f7e26f8051d5af20dac493e13:0
- 20052c4750276dd67322e05e4dfdf40f2103936f7e26f8051d5af20dac493e13:1
value 1369944
address 33YJF5kNDHi7HM2cgn6764NUTUpQavzxKU
value 3580994
address 1HNYVySZTjgSWgKHGr3xPLjAkMNNn9CjbY